PERKALIAN MATRIKS 2X2 DALAM BAHASA C

 /* perkalian matriks

*/

#include <stdio.h>

int main()

{

    int matriks1 [2][2];

    int matriks2 [2][2];

    int matriks3 [2][2];

    int i;

    int j;

    int kali;

    for(i = 0;i<2;i++)

    {

        for(j=0;j<2;j++)

        {

            printf("masukan angka matriks1 \n");

            scanf("%d",&matriks1[i][j]);

        }

    }

    for(i = 0;i<2;i++)

    {

        for(j=0;j<2;j++)

        {

            printf("masukan angka matriks2 \n");

            scanf("%d",&matriks2[i][j]);

        }

    }

      for(i = 0;i<2;i++)

    {

        for(j=0;j<2;j++)

        {

            matriks3[i][j] = 0;

            for(kali = 0; kali<2;kali++)

            {

                matriks3[i][j] = matriks3[i][j] + matriks1[i][kali] * matriks2[kali][j];

            }

        }

    }

    for(i = 0;i<2;i++)

    {

        for(j=0;j<2;j++)

        {

            printf("%d",matriks3[i][j]);

        }

    }

    return 0;

    

}


Komentar

Postingan populer dari blog ini

Pentingnya Mendapatkan Sertifikasi di Bidang IT/Sebagai Programmer

Pengantar Java Swing Bagian 1

Pengenalan UML